Columbia Women’s Newton Ridge Plus Waterproof Amped Hiking Boot vs La Sportiva TX Hike Mid GTX

| Weight | 13.8 oz (per shoe) | 14.4 oz (per shoe) |
| Upper Material | Full grain leather and suede | Recycled AirMesh / TPU overlays |
| Midsole Material | Techlite™ | Compression EVA with Co-Molded Stabilizing insert |
| Drop | N/A | 0.39 in |
| Lacing System | Lace | Recycled Laces & Nylon® Webbing |
| Warranty | 1 year | 1 year |
| Toe Cap | N/A | Welded TPU overlays |
| Rock Plate | N/A | N/A |
| Size Range | Standard: US W 5-12 | Women's: 5.5–11 |
| Waterproof Membrane | Omni-Tech | ePE GORE-TEX |
| Midsole Platform | N/A | N/A |
| Eva Midsole | Techlite EVA | Compression EVA |

Comfort
Women’s Newton Ridge Plus Waterproof Amped Hiking Boot
TX Hike Mid GTX
Comfort is the cornerstone of any successful hike, determining whether your feet remain pain-free over long distances or become a source of distraction. For buyers, a higher comfort rating usually translates to better cushioning, lighter weight, and immediate wearability without a painful break-in period. The Columbia Newton Ridge Plus Amped leads this category decisively with a 4.4/5 rating backed by over 850 mentions, where users consistently highlight its lightweight feel and ample toe room even with thick socks. The La Sportiva TX Hike Mid GTX scores a respectable 4.2/5, with buyers noting it is comfortable out of the box and offers excellent underfoot cushioning, but the feedback volume is significantly lower. Given the overwhelming evidence of long-term wearability and the specific praise for the Columbia's lightweight design, it is the superior choice for all-day comfort.
Durability
Women’s Newton Ridge Plus Waterproof Amped Hiking Boot
TX Hike Mid GTX
Durability dictates how well a boot withstands abrasion, weather, and repeated use over seasons of adventure. A durable boot protects your investment by maintaining structural integrity and waterproofing long after the initial purchase. The Columbia Newton Ridge Plus Amped excels here with a 4.6/5 rating, supported by hundreds of reviews confirming its quality construction and ability to last through many adventures. Users specifically note that the tread maintains its appearance and the boots feel built to last. The La Sportiva TX Hike Mid GTX holds a 4.1/5 rating, with some users reporting impressive mileage of over 1,300 miles and praising its abrasion-resistant mesh uppers. However, the Columbia's significantly larger dataset of positive durability feedback and its reputation for long-term resilience make it the more reliable option for frequent hikers.
Fit
Women’s Newton Ridge Plus Waterproof Amped Hiking Boot
TX Hike Mid GTX
A proper fit is critical for preventing blisters and ensuring stability, requiring a balance between a secure heel and enough room for toe splay. Buyers need a boot that accommodates their foot shape without causing pressure points or slipping. The Columbia Newton Ridge Plus Amped earns a 3.9/5 rating, with many users appreciating the roomy toe box that allows for thick socks, though some note that the fit can be inconsistent and may require careful sizing. The La Sportiva TX Hike Mid GTX scores slightly lower at 3.7/5, with limited feedback suggesting a wide fit and an effective lacing system that secures the foot well. While both boots offer roomy toe boxes, the Columbia's higher volume of positive fit reviews and its ability to accommodate various sock thicknesses give it a slight edge for the average buyer.
Stability
Women’s Newton Ridge Plus Waterproof Amped Hiking Boot
TX Hike Mid GTX
Stability refers to a boot's ability to support the ankle and maintain balance on uneven, rocky, or slippery terrain. Strong stability reduces the risk of twists and falls, providing confidence on technical descents. The Columbia Newton Ridge Plus Amped dominates this category with a 4.6/5 rating, where users praise its strong ankle support and reliable performance on various terrains. The La Sportiva TX Hike Mid GTX follows with a 4.1/5 rating, offering good support, a solid heel cup, and a firm ride that allows for a good range of motion. While the La Sportiva provides a stable platform, the Columbia's extensive user validation regarding its support on diverse surfaces makes it the more trustworthy choice for stability-focused hikers.
Breathability
Women’s Newton Ridge Plus Waterproof Amped Hiking Boot
TX Hike Mid GTX
Breathability is essential for regulating foot temperature and preventing sweat buildup, which can lead to discomfort and blisters during warm weather or strenuous climbs. A breathable boot keeps feet cool and dry from the inside out, complementing external waterproofing. The Columbia Newton Ridge Plus Amped is a standout here with a near-perfect 4.9/5 rating, with users frequently describing it as highly breathable and lightweight. In contrast, the La Sportiva TX Hike Mid GTX scores 3.7/5; while it features a Gore-Tex membrane, buyers note that breathability is not its strongest suit, often resulting in warmer feet in hot conditions. For hikers who prioritize staying cool or hike in variable temperatures, the Columbia is the clear winner.
Traction
Women’s Newton Ridge Plus Waterproof Amped Hiking Boot
TX Hike Mid GTX
Traction ensures a secure grip on wet rocks, mud, and loose gravel, directly impacting safety and confidence on the trail. High traction ratings indicate an outsole design that bites into surfaces effectively without slipping. The Columbia Newton Ridge Plus Amped leads with a 4.6/5 rating, with users confirming excellent grip and water resistance on wet or uneven surfaces. The La Sportiva TX Hike Mid GTX is a strong contender with a 4.2/5 rating, featuring a Vibram Ecoep Evo outsole that provides exceptional grip and deep treads for rugged terrain. Although the La Sportiva is highly regarded for technical grip, the Columbia's broader consensus on reliable traction across various conditions, combined with its superior water resistance, makes it the more versatile option.

Conclusion & Final Verdict:
The Columbia Women’s Newton Ridge Plus Waterproof Amped Hiking Boot is the clear winner for most hikers, offering superior comfort, breathability, and durability backed by extensive user validation. It is the ideal choice for those seeking a reliable, lightweight boot for wet conditions and long trails without sacrificing foot health. The La Sportiva TX Hike Mid GTX remains a strong alternative for technical hikers who prioritize a specific Vibram outsole and Gore-Tex protection, provided they can tolerate slightly less breathability and a narrower fit profile. If you value a proven track record of all-day comfort and consistent performance, the Columbia is the practical verdict.
